2.2  Electrical system design

For safety reasons, the use of a DC switch is recommended. Between the 
PV modules and the power modules may be mandatory in some countrie.

The selection of PV string output should be based on the optimum utilization of the invested capital compared to the 
expected annual energy yield from the system. This optimization depends on local weather conditions and should be 

considered in each individual case.

The inverter incorporates an input power limiting device, which automatically keeps the power at levels that are safe for the 
inverter. The limitation depends mainly on internal and ambient temperatures. The limitation is calculated continuously and 
always allows the maximum possible amount of energy to be produced.

Please use the tool supplied by Renac Power when dimensioning a photovoltaic system.
